Joe Tallari

Joe Tallari (born October 5, 1980) is a Canadian former professional ice hockey player.

Over the following three seasons, Tallari switched between teams in the ECHL and the AHL, with stints at the Cleveland Barons, the Bridgeport Sound Tigers (on two occasions) and the Las Vegas Wranglers.

He then moved to Europe, signing with the Manchester Phoenix in the summer of 2007 to play under Tony Hand.

In April 2008 it was announced that Tallari would leave Manchester to sign for the Hockey Club Pustertal-Val Pusteria to try to qualify for the Italian national team.

[2] On 7 May 2009 he left Hockey Club Pustertal-Val Pusteria and signed a contract with HC Eppan Pirats Internorm.
